The Rising Influence of AI in Sports Predictions
The integration of artificial intelligence in sports analytics has become increasingly vital, particularly as we approach significant events like the FIFA World Cup. As excitement builds for the 2026 tournament, AI models are being employed to make informed predictions about team performances and potential victors. This method not only analyzes past performances but also considers real-time data, injuries, and player form, providing a comprehensive outlook on the competition.
The Role of Historical Data and Current Trends
By examining historical match outcomes, analysts can identify patterns that tend to repeat over time. For example, the data from previous World Cups shows that historically strong teams like France and Brazil often perform well under pressure. The upcoming tournament will likely follow this trend, with AI suggesting that these teams, alongside Argentina, could be the frontrunners. Notably, the statistical models highlight the importance of key player performances, which can dramatically alter the odds.
Insights on Asian Teams and Emerging Players
The Asian football scene is evolving, with countries like Japan and South Korea consistently breaking into the global stage. The 2026 World Cup may see a more competitive Asian representation, particularly with talents emerging from leagues in Indonesia and surrounding Southeast Asia. These players offer a fresh dynamic that could disrupt traditional powerhouses.
